A lowboy is a small table with drawers introduced in the 18th century, designed primarily as a dressing table or side table during the William and Mary, Queen Anne, and Georgian periods.

Georgian lowboys were predominantly crafted using walnut, mahogany, or oak, featuring dovetail drawer joints, crossbanded or feathered wood veneers, and cast brass backplate handles.

Authentic pieces feature hand-cut dovetail drawer joints, secondary timber linings such as pine or oak, natural timber shrinkage across wide boards, and hand-cast brass hardware with original fitting marks.

A lowboy serves as a compact hallway console table, a unique bedside table, or an occasional writing desk in a home office or living space.

Apply a high-grade beeswax polish periodically along the grain and keep the table away from direct sunlight, radiators, or moist environments to prevent veneer lifting.
